Laura Natali will defend her PhD thesis on March 28th, 2025. The defense will take place in PJ, Institutionen för fysik, Origovägen 6b, Göteborg, at 10:00.

Title: Neural Networks for Complex Systems: From Epidemic Modeling to Swarm Robotics

Abstract: Deep learning models, inspired by the structure of the brain, were first developed in the last century. These models are trained to recognize patterns in large amounts of data. Recently, deep learning has made a big impact, both in research and in everyday applications, like healthcare, image recognition, and language translation.

However, despite their advancements, these models still fall short of the abilities found in biological brains, which are adaptable, energy-efficient, and have evolved over millions of years. In contrast, artificial models are specialized and struggle to adapt to new information.

To help address this gap, we have developed a robotic experiment that combines the programmability of artificial neural networks with some of the physical constraints seen in biological systems.
